Evergreen Bunching Onion is an heirloom, open pollinated variety that is a scallion type bunching onion. This cold hardy variety can be fall planted to overwinter for an abundant early spring crop of scallion goodness. Evergreen Bunching produces a petite bulb and short shank that gives way to a plentiful bunch of long tubular "leaves" that are stalk like. All parts of the plant are edible and widely used for flavoring soups, salads, casseroles and as a delicious mild flavored garnish topping. 120 days. Packet: approx. 250 seeds.
